summ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Christian Heim <phreak@gentoo.org>2008-01-02 13:29:36 +0000
committerChristian Heim <phreak@gentoo.org>2008-01-02 13:29:36 +0000
commit23c4dcf4ca63d14c38e3bd06bb0f9c36bc59786d (patch)
treec455c4f664c6d8f886631d28056e9f1629c74f9a
parentAdding keywords for sys-libs/uclibc-0.9.28.3-r2. (diff)
downloadphreak-23c4dcf4ca63d14c38e3bd06bb0f9c36bc59786d.tar.gz
phreak-23c4dcf4ca63d14c38e3bd06bb0f9c36bc59786d.tar.bz2
phreak-23c4dcf4ca63d14c38e3bd06bb0f9c36bc59786d.zip
Updating the ebuild, as solar added it to the main tree.
svn path=/; revision=379
-rw-r--r--catalyst/portage_overlay/uclibc/sys-libs/uclibc/Manifest24
-rw-r--r--cat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/digest-uclibc-0.9.28.3-r2 (renamed from cat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/digest-uclibc-0.9.28.3)6
-rw-r--r--cat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/uclibc-0.9.28.3-netdb.h.patch42
-rw-r--r--catalyst/portage_overlay/uclibc/sys-libs/uclibc/uclibc-0.9.28.3-r2.ebuild (renamed from catalyst/portage_overlay/uclibc/sys-libs/uclibc/uclibc-0.9.28.3.ebuild)9
4 files changed, 15 insertions, 66 deletions
diff --git a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/Manifest b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/Manifest
index 2583c04..45aefa0 100644
--- a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/Manifest
+++ b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/Manifest
@@ -1,18 +1,10 @@
-AUX uclibc-0.9.28.3-netdb.h.patch 2152 RMD160 d7beb30ac5c99c50a2479a6220698cf83738f14e SHA1 155656140cc0f78d9732ba2ac84af5e27431be4c SHA256 f7b1f3e24d81c5766a90427399e93efd8fe50a94e1ad3c86624d565025e3e6e3
-MD5 30a04878f6a8be5893b01bb5d9a7a3ef files/uclibc-0.9.28.3-netdb.h.patch 2152
-RMD160 d7beb30ac5c99c50a2479a6220698cf83738f14e files/uclibc-0.9.28.3-netdb.h.patch 2152
-SHA256 f7b1f3e24d81c5766a90427399e93efd8fe50a94e1ad3c86624d565025e3e6e3 files/uclibc-0.9.28.3-netdb.h.patch 2152
-DIST uClibc-0.9.28.3-patches-1.0.tar.bz2 16079 RMD160 2224a7b826932fcd5c96a0bddb30fcfa4173de35 SHA1 098f90da4879bc3a14afe662f19163c969bde431 SHA256 c432d869fc3e8a4e2137541e8a1ab93e7d634387d9ca5131842721f4b080b72e
+DIST uClibc-0.9.28.3-patches-1.2.tar.bz2 17096 RMD160 f7ab3b4ff648c6c39edd53145bd95678b1d38093 SHA1 be59a9ebb2f14a1e26c9241282b0e1f0d095e6d6 SHA256 cbcf7d5e2923335d4123bc713357a236329c1bb58bb3acb0d11e63c517c6d0d7
DIST uClibc-0.9.28.3.tar.bz2 1795383 RMD160 61591281f4193d4dcd0fa3252fb3286028d4cb63 SHA1 77c5220697a1772d0d9da4bda0d866e4f4b68540 SHA256 1d86d5dad6060e7057cfe023ffc7b7661bdc7fe95112b37447851c0a75b547a1
DIST uClibc-locale-030818.tgz 236073 RMD160 8e3f4b20b94e07e535cbbbe81287186014c5f151 SHA1 78f901e6ed228ed84106bd034c1b97eee1eecb50 SHA256 c4362be318a38f18d98dccf462d22d95bab92f05548bb93f65298fe9afaebd57
-EBUILD uclibc-0.9.28.3.ebuild 14504 RMD160 fc0979bb036b26567bbd675b10300d104c7f4835 SHA1 ff586f3ca4a5aa1d06080a38bea9355d1f987191 SHA256 90d14df168e7d6b157ed1f1d98926fad9a9e61b1387578c4082e2162f2922a83
-MD5 198bdf1b3c6f7bce068ec748f3f7b784 uclibc-0.9.28.3.ebuild 14504
-RMD160 fc0979bb036b26567bbd675b10300d104c7f4835 uclibc-0.9.28.3.ebuild 14504
-SHA256 90d14df168e7d6b157ed1f1d98926fad9a9e61b1387578c4082e2162f2922a83 uclibc-0.9.28.3.ebuild 14504
-MISC ChangeLog 11727 RMD160 5cd822b4084cfb49ac72a03da58f43e04b52f037 SHA1 ce5c53ff9ed754a3e9f8d019be9f76718f5a199c SHA256 8b3a1a355f492c58944d8ecae8dc40d24e1cf905d133315f4177dd9b8836933e
-MD5 4765337ea0d3f4d004bfc0936e727501 ChangeLog 11727
-RMD160 5cd822b4084cfb49ac72a03da58f43e04b52f037 ChangeLog 11727
-SHA256 8b3a1a355f492c58944d8ecae8dc40d24e1cf905d133315f4177dd9b8836933e ChangeLog 11727
-MD5 9bc0f6bda7c1bd0b9b8241eaf2389765 files/digest-uclibc-0.9.28.3 720
-RMD160 b28252fdca7ae9f199603e2dec741e5c8b31a91b files/digest-uclibc-0.9.28.3 720
-SHA256 23e08c12e0c3bb18d9e8ba6a954967db36d9ab891173457025b9ec2a40dd355a files/digest-uclibc-0.9.28.3 720
+EBUILD uclibc-0.9.28.3-r2.ebuild 14471 RMD160 c5f99d3a19b9df8bdf835031aa4cf823a00033a5 SHA1 a1cb9ed59823141dd6c414583af435d4d9ff60a1 SHA256 b5f932940edaeb545d3ba00e3b496da216ffb92a7f0e2d1ae84b959a0722d999
+MD5 0e966b201e2e578aee8d963c44a3e026 uclibc-0.9.28.3-r2.ebuild 14471
+RMD160 c5f99d3a19b9df8bdf835031aa4cf823a00033a5 uclibc-0.9.28.3-r2.ebuild 14471
+SHA256 b5f932940edaeb545d3ba00e3b496da216ffb92a7f0e2d1ae84b959a0722d999 uclibc-0.9.28.3-r2.ebuild 14471
+MD5 8c6979345d70c3acc8b7ccb3388a2ddc files/digest-uclibc-0.9.28.3-r2 720
+RMD160 481c12e16c24708de9b29598c3c4b9a5b9c59cae files/digest-uclibc-0.9.28.3-r2 720
+SHA256 0889bcd1b069110bd6008df309bd4139a9dde5ff4b185d5155792d66c334eda5 files/digest-uclibc-0.9.28.3-r2 720
diff --git a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/digest-uclibc-0.9.28.3 b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/digest-uclibc-0.9.28.3-r2
index 8e2fe37..2b7a1e8 100644
--- a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/digest-uclibc-0.9.28.3
+++ b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/digest-uclibc-0.9.28.3-r2
@@ -1,6 +1,6 @@
-MD5 16700ec373e17f63a96a4f27259e0460 uClibc-0.9.28.3-patches-1.0.tar.bz2 16079
-RMD160 2224a7b826932fcd5c96a0bddb30fcfa4173de35 uClibc-0.9.28.3-patches-1.0.tar.bz2 16079
-SHA256 c432d869fc3e8a4e2137541e8a1ab93e7d634387d9ca5131842721f4b080b72e uClibc-0.9.28.3-patches-1.0.tar.bz2 16079
+MD5 08d3756a07c00298b6a639c3b0f1ce0c uClibc-0.9.28.3-patches-1.2.tar.bz2 17096
+RMD160 f7ab3b4ff648c6c39edd53145bd95678b1d38093 uClibc-0.9.28.3-patches-1.2.tar.bz2 17096
+SHA256 cbcf7d5e2923335d4123bc713357a236329c1bb58bb3acb0d11e63c517c6d0d7 uClibc-0.9.28.3-patches-1.2.tar.bz2 17096
MD5 428405a36b4662980d9343b32089b5a6 uClibc-0.9.28.3.tar.bz2 1795383
RMD160 61591281f4193d4dcd0fa3252fb3286028d4cb63 uClibc-0.9.28.3.tar.bz2 1795383
SHA256 1d86d5dad6060e7057cfe023ffc7b7661bdc7fe95112b37447851c0a75b547a1 uClibc-0.9.28.3.tar.bz2 1795383
diff --git a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/uclibc-0.9.28.3-netdb.h.patch b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/uclibc-0.9.28.3-netdb.h.patch
deleted file mode 100644
index a6f26ad..0000000
--- a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/files/uclibc-0.9.28.3-netdb.h.patch
+++ /dev/null
@@ -1,42 +0,0 @@
-diff -Nrup uClibc-0.9.28.3.orig/include/netdb.h uClibc-0.9.28.3/include/netdb.h
---- uClibc-0.9.28.3.orig/include/netdb.h 2004-09-08 05:07:17.000000000 +0200
-+++ uClibc-0.9.28.3/include/netdb.h 2008-01-01 17:18:16.000000000 +0100
-@@ -401,6 +401,9 @@ struct addrinfo
- # define AI_PASSIVE 0x0001 /* Socket address is intended for `bind'. */
- # define AI_CANONNAME 0x0002 /* Request for canonical name. */
- # define AI_NUMERICHOST 0x0004 /* Don't use name resolution. */
-+# define AI_V4MAPPED 0x0008 /* IPv4 mapped addresses are acceptable. */
-+# define AI_ALL 0x0010 /* Return IPv4 mapped and IPv6 addresses. */
-+# define AI_ADDRCONFIG 0x0020 /* Use configuration of this host to choose
-
- /* Error values for `getaddrinfo' function. */
- # define EAI_BADFLAGS -1 /* Invalid value for `ai_flags' field. */
-@@ -414,12 +417,14 @@ struct addrinfo
- # define EAI_ADDRFAMILY -9 /* Address family for NAME not supported. */
- # define EAI_MEMORY -10 /* Memory allocation failure. */
- # define EAI_SYSTEM -11 /* System error returned in `errno'. */
-+# define EAI_OVERFLOW -12 /* Argument buffer overflow. */
- # ifdef __USE_GNU
- # define EAI_INPROGRESS -100 /* Processing request in progress. */
- # define EAI_CANCELED -101 /* Request canceled. */
- # define EAI_NOTCANCELED -102 /* Request not canceled. */
- # define EAI_ALLDONE -103 /* All requests done. */
- # define EAI_INTR -104 /* Interrupted by a signal. */
-+# define EAI_IDN_ENCODE -105 /* IDN encoding failed. */
- # endif
-
- # define NI_MAXHOST 1025
-@@ -430,6 +435,13 @@ struct addrinfo
- # define NI_NOFQDN 4 /* Only return nodename portion. */
- # define NI_NAMEREQD 8 /* Don't return numeric addresses. */
- # define NI_DGRAM 16 /* Look up UDP service rather than TCP. */
-+# ifdef __USE_GNU
-+# define NI_IDN 32 /* Convert name from IDN format. */
-+# define NI_IDN_ALLOW_UNASSIGNED 64 /* Don't reject unassigned Unicode
-+ code points. */
-+# define NI_IDN_USE_STD3_ASCII_RULES 128 /* Validate strings according to
-+ STD3 rules. */
-+# endif
-
- /* Translate name of a service location and/or a service name to set of
- socket addresses. */
diff --git a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/uclibc-0.9.28.3.ebuild b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/uclibc-0.9.28.3-r2.ebuild
index f231938..6938160 100644
--- a/catalyst/portage_overlay/uclibc/sys-libs/uclibc/uclibc-0.9.28.3.ebuild
+++ b/catalyst/portage_overlay/uclibc/sys-libs/uclibc/uclibc-0.9.28.3-r2.ebuild
@@ -1,6 +1,6 @@
-# Copyright 1999-2007 Gentoo Foundation
+# Copyright 1999-2008 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sys-libs/uclibc/uclibc-0.9.28.3.ebuild,v 1.5 2007/07/02 15:35:40 peper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-libs/uclibc/uclibc-0.9.28.3-r2.ebuild,v 1.1 2008/01/01 23:28:54 solar Exp $
#ESVN_REPO_URI="svn://uclibc.org/trunk/uClibc"
#inherit subversion
@@ -21,7 +21,7 @@ fi
MY_P=uClibc-${PV}
SVN_VER=""
-PATCH_VER="1.0"
+PATCH_VER="1.2"
DESCRIPTION="C library for developing embedded Linux systems"
HOMEPAGE="http://www.uclibc.org/"
SRC_URI="mirror://kernel/linux/libs/uclibc/${MY_P}.tar.bz2
@@ -38,7 +38,7 @@ LICENSE="LGPL-2"
[[ ${CTARGET} != ${CHOST} ]] \
&& SLOT="${CTARGET}" \
|| SLOT="0"
-KEYWORDS="-* arm m68k -mips ppc sh sparc x86"
+KEYWORDS="-* ~arm ~m68k -mips ~ppc ~sh ~sparc ~x86"
IUSE="build uclibc-compat debug hardened iconv ipv6 minimal nls pregen savedconfig userlocales wordexp"
RESTRICT="strip"
@@ -173,7 +173,6 @@ src_unpack() {
# math functions (sinf,cosf,tanf,atan2f,powf,fabsf,copysignf,scalbnf,rem_pio2f)
cp "${WORKDIR}"/patch/math/libm/* "${S}"/libm/ || die
epatch "${WORKDIR}"/patch/math
- epatch "${FILESDIR}"/${P}-netdb.h.patch
fi
########## CPU SELECTION ##########